To adjust the transparency of the shape, click More Fill Colors. At the bottom of the Colors dialog box, move the Transparency slider, or enter a number in the box next to the slider. You can vary the percentage of transparency from 0% (fully opaque, the default setting) to 100% (fully transparent).
Figure 4. Place your text box, as normal. Right-click on the text box. Choose Format Shape from the Context menu. Click the Fill and Line icon (it looks like a spilling paint bucket). Click on the Fill option to expand it. Use the Transparency slider to adjust how transparent you want the Text Box to be.

Text Opacity CSS You can set the opacity of an entire element the background, text within the element, the border, and everything else using the opacity property. To set the opacity of text and only text, then you need to use the CSS color property and RGBA color values.
Click View View Textboxes. The two textboxes you added should disappear. To hide a control, simply set its Visible property to False. If you want to get it back, show a control by setting the Visible property to True.

Enable or disable text wrapping for a text box, rich text box, or expression box. Right-click the control for which you want to enable or disable text wrapping, and then click Control Properties on the shortcut menu. Click the Display tab. Select or clear the Wrap text check box.
